Multi Door Locker Planning for Busy Facilities

Multi Door Locker Planning for Busy Facilities

A locker room can become inefficient long before it appears full. Lost keys, doors left open, overcrowded changing areas, and damaged units all create daily work for facility teams. A properly specified multi door locker addresses those issues by giving more users secure personal storage within the same floor area, while keeping service and maintenance manageable.

For procurement managers and project planners, the product is not simply a cabinet with multiple compartments. It is part of the facility’s daily operating system. The right configuration supports shift changes, visitor flow, hygiene requirements, asset protection, and future expansion. The wrong one can create congestion, raise replacement costs, and force a layout change sooner than expected.

Where a Multi Door Locker Delivers the Most Value

Multi-compartment lockers are designed for locations where individual storage is needed but available wall space is limited. They are common in factories, warehouses, schools, gyms, offices, hospitals, public facilities, and staff changing rooms. Rather than allocating one full-height cabinet to each person, a single locker body can serve several users.

This density has a clear commercial benefit. A six-door or twelve-door arrangement can increase the number of available storage spaces without expanding the room footprint. That matters in projects where changing rooms, corridors, break areas, or reception zones must perform multiple functions.

The best door count depends on what users need to store. Small compartments work well for personal items, wallets, phones, documents, and light work gear. Full-height doors are more appropriate for uniforms, coats, helmets, bags, or PPE that must hang vertically. A mixed locker layout can be useful when a facility has different employee groups or combines day-use storage with longer-term allocation.

High density is not automatically the right choice. If each user carries bulky equipment, very small doors only shift the storage problem elsewhere. Planning should begin with the items being stored, not with the maximum number of doors that can fit into a cabinet.

Choosing the Right Multi Door Locker Configuration

A practical specification starts with user volume and usage pattern. A school may need a fixed locker for every student throughout the term. A logistics site with rotating shifts may need fewer compartments than employees because lockers are shared between shifts. A gym may require frequent short-term use and easy lock management, while an industrial site may need separate storage for clean clothing and workwear.

Match compartment size to the stored items

Ask users or department managers what goes into the locker at the busiest point of the day. This prevents a common purchasing error: selecting compact compartments based on headcount alone. A small door format may be ideal for a call center or visitor area, but unsuitable for a welding team carrying protective clothing and boots.

Internal features should follow the same logic. Coat hooks and hanging rails support uniforms and garments. Adjustable shelves suit bags, devices, or supplies. Ventilation openings are valuable where damp clothing, footwear, or PPE is stored. For sensitive items, consider a compartment size that allows equipment to be placed flat rather than forced inside.

Plan the room, not only the cabinet

Locker dimensions affect circulation. Door swing, aisle width, bench placement, and accessible reach all need consideration before an order is placed. A high-capacity locker bank can look efficient on a drawing but become difficult to use during shift changes if people cannot open doors and move past one another.

Wall-mounted units can free up floor space in suitable locations, while sloping tops can reduce dust collection in facilities with strict cleaning routines. Raised bases are useful where floors are washed regularly or where moisture protection is a concern. For changing rooms, benches should be positioned so they improve comfort without blocking locker access.

Select locking based on how lockers are assigned

The lock should reflect the management model. Key locks remain familiar and cost-effective for permanently assigned employee lockers, although keys require replacement and tracking. Padlock fittings give users control over their own locks, often making sense in gyms, schools, and short-term facilities.

Combination locks reduce key administration but need a clear reset process. Digital and RFID locking systems offer greater control over access, allocation, and temporary use, especially in larger sites. They also add cost and may require power, battery management, software, or staff training. The best option is the one the facility can operate consistently, not the most complex option on a specification sheet.

Construction Details That Affect Service Life

Commercial lockers experience repeated impacts, door cycles, and cleaning. Steel thickness, reinforcement, hinge design, welding quality, and powder coating all affect how well a locker performs over time. For high-use sites, industrial-grade metal construction is often the better long-term purchase because it holds alignment and resists damage under regular use.

Door stiffness deserves close attention. A door that flexes easily can affect lock engagement and create visible wear around the frame. Reinforced doors and dependable hinge systems help maintain alignment, especially where users open and close compartments several times a day.

Powder-coated finishes provide a durable surface for commercial interiors and can be specified in colors that support zoning, department identification, or a site’s interior standard. Light colors may make cleaning needs more visible, while darker finishes can better conceal scuffs in industrial environments. Neither is universally better. The right choice depends on cleaning practices, traffic level, and the appearance expected by the facility.

Ventilation should be specified as a functional requirement, not a decorative detail. Perforations or vents allow air movement for clothing and equipment, but they may not suit every security or privacy requirement. Where odor, moisture, or hygiene is a concern, ventilation, cleaning access, and locker allocation policies should work together.

Standard Products or Custom Manufacturing?

Standard locker sizes and door configurations are usually the fastest route for projects with common storage needs. They simplify comparison, support faster delivery, and make it easier to add matching units later. They are a strong fit when the available room, user items, and locking method follow established patterns.

Custom production becomes valuable when a standard cabinet creates compromises. This may include a restricted wall length, unusual ceiling height, a required compartment size, integrated seating, special colors, charging capability, or a need to match existing site furniture. It can also be appropriate where a project needs a combination of personal lockers, PPE storage, office cabinets, and shelving from one manufacturing source.

Customization should still be controlled. Every nonstandard change can affect cost, lead time, installation, and future replacement planning. The most effective approach is to customize only where the operational gain is clear. For example, increasing compartment depth for safety helmets may solve a real problem; changing a standard dimension by a small amount for appearance alone may not.

A Procurement Checklist Before You Order

Before finalizing a multi door locker order, confirm the number of users, whether lockers are assigned or shared, the largest items stored, the preferred locking method, and the space available for installation and circulation. Also define the expected cleaning method, any ventilation need, floor conditions, and whether the units will be relocated in the future.

For larger orders, request clear product information covering external dimensions, internal compartment dimensions, steel construction, finish, lock preparation, ventilation, base options, and assembly method. These details help avoid assumptions between the buyer, installer, and end user.

It is also wise to consider spare parts from the start. Replacement keys, locks, number plates, and adjustable components are small items, but having a service plan can prevent a minor failure from taking a compartment out of use for weeks. A long product warranty is valuable, yet daily care and straightforward access to service components matter just as much.

A multi door locker should make the working day easier: users know where their belongings belong, supervisors spend less time resolving access issues, and facilities retain a clean, organized appearance. Specify for real use, allow room for maintenance, and choose construction that can keep pace with the people using it.
